USC sophomore tailback Stafon Johnson emerged as one of the Trojans most productive running backs in 2007. This is your chance to go beyond the stats and find out Stafon Johnson’s best sports memory, favorite win, best player he ever played against and much more.

#13 Stafon Johnson
Tailback
6-1, 210 So.
Bellflower, CA (Dorsey HS)

After a challenging freshman year Stafon Johnson emerged as one of the Trojans most productive running backs in 2007. Johnson, a local kid from Dorsey HS, really came into his own in his second season at USC. The 6-1, 210-pound tailback rushed for 673 yards and 5 touchdowns. Johnson will compete for the starting tailback spot in 2008 and has a very bright future ahead of him.

Favorite Professional Sports Team: Broncos

Favorite Athlete: Barry Sanders

Favorite Music Artist/Group: Busta Rhymes

Person You Admire Most: My Grandad.

Hobbies: Bowling

Career After Football: Some sort of businessman.

Favorite TV Show: College Hill on BET.

Best Sports Memory: Semi-finals in my junior year at Dorsey HS. We played Crenshaw, our rivals, and won to make it to the finals.

Reason for choosing USC: Hometown kid.

Best Win: Nebraska

Toughest Loss: Stanford

Best player you ever played against: Reggie Carter, I played against him in high school. He’s now at UCLA.

Best player you played with: Jeremiah Johnson at Dorsey HS (Oregon)

Favorite Movie: The Patriot

Most Prized Possession: My family

Chris Rock or Dave Chapelle: Dave Chapelle

50 Cent or Kanye West: 50 Cent

Lebron James or Kobe Bryant: Lebron James

Peyton Manning or Tom Brady: Tom Brady

Jay Leno or David Letterman: Jay Leno
